About this map

Collins Mountain and the high ridges of northwestern Alabama dominate this landscape, where the northern reaches of Colbert County meet Franklin and Lawrence. This area shows a transition from the agricultural lowlands near Town Creek to the industrial activity visible at the Strip mines near the northern boundary. The settlement at Old Bethel serves as a local hub, anchored by the Old Bethel Church and the nearby La Grange Sch.
